North Dakota Farmers Union President Mark Watne is hearing concerns from members about what is happening in the insurance sector. “Premiums are probably going up and it’s industry wide,” said Watne. “That comes with the fact that we’re having very severe storms that tend to impact the price of insurance products that we buy.” Watne participated in a Q & A session where he addressed membership concerns. Topics addressed included the state’s corporate farming law in the state, the expansion of animal agriculture and the soy crush. Hear the full recap with Mark Watne here.
